如何高效获取和使用代理IP?全面解析最佳实践

在爬虫与数据采集日益盛行的今天,代理IP已成为不可或缺的核心工具。尤其对于刚接触数据抓取的新手来说,学会正确获取并配置代理IP,不仅能提升效率,更能有效规避网站封锁与IP封禁等问题。本文将围绕“如何选择、测试、配置与轮换代理IP”这四大步骤,带你掌握代理IP使用的核心技巧。
一、明晰需求,选对代理类型更关键
在选择代理IP之前,首要任务是明确自身的业务目标与目标网站的反爬策略:
- 普通资讯类网站:建议选择数据中心代理,这类IP由IDC机房提供,访问速度快、价格实惠,适合大规模抓取新闻、论坛等开放性数据。
- 电商/视频平台:此类平台反爬较强,需使用住宅代理,因为它基于真实家庭网络,更能模拟真实用户行为。
- 地域特定任务:如果需要采集某地数据,如北京、上海,应优先选购对应地域的IP资源,以避免地域访问限制。
许多服务商(如中海云等)都支持按照地区和用途筛选IP类型,新手应避免盲目购买全量套餐,量力而行。
二、小批量试用,确保可用性再扩展
对于初次使用代理IP的新用户,推荐从小套餐或试用包开始:
- 购买少量IP资源(如10-50个)进行初步测试;
- 使用浏览器手动设置代理,在目标网站上验证能否正常访问页面;
- 测试是否存在被封禁、访问速度慢或DNS解析失败等异常。
有效的IP应能在目标平台持续访问多个页面且无明显卡顿或异常提示。
三、配置细节别忽略,新手常见误区避开
将代理IP集成到爬虫项目中时,务必注意以下几点:
- 协议匹配:HTTP与HTTPS代理不可混用,否则将导致连接错误;
- 格式规范:代理格式需为“IP:端口号”,中间无空格,尤其是在Python等语言中调用时;
- 容错机制:建议配置自动切换功能,当一个IP不可用或请求超时时,程序能切换至下一个IP继续执行。
许多新手常因遗漏错误处理而导致爬虫频繁中断,这是可以通过简单的异常捕获机制避免的。
四、代理IP轮换策略,助你持久运行
轮换代理IP是确保稳定采集的关键策略,常见的三种轮换机制如下:
- 按请求次数轮换:如每发送10次请求更换一次代理,适合短频操作;
- 按时间间隔轮换:如每隔20-30分钟替换IP池,适合长时间运行任务;
- 按返回状态轮换:如出现403、429等错误码时立即切换IP并记录异常。
有用户反馈,通过设置“每15次请求自动轮换IP”,使原本只能运行一小时的爬虫成功稳定运行了一整天,大幅提升了数据采集效率。
对于数据采集新手来说,合理使用代理IP是实现高效爬取与稳定运行的关键环节。从选型、测试、配置到轮换,每一步都影响最终成果。选择一个专业、稳定、支持灵活配置的IP服务商(如中海云)更是事半功倍的保障。跟着本文的流程操作,你也可以快速掌握代理IP使用的正确姿势,轻松迈入数据智能化的第一步。
延伸阅读:
代理 IP 如何助力搜索引擎优化实现精准数据监测
在现代 SEO 实践中,代理 IP 已成为搜索排名监控和数据分析的重要工具。搜索引擎根据用户的地理位置、访问频率及网络环...
高匿名代理 IP 的安全价值与企业应用分析
在现代网络环境下,代理 IP 的匿名性已成为影响访问成功率和网络安全的重要因素。不同类型的代理 IP 在匿名保护能力上存...
HTTP 代理与 SOCKS5 代理怎么选?协议层面的差异解析
在代理 IP 的实际应用中,HTTP 代理与 SOCKS5 代理是最常被提及的两种协议类型。二者虽然同属代理技术体系,但...
代理 IP 如何助力跨境电商本地化运营与账号稳定
在跨境电商快速发展的背景下,企业面临的不仅是物流、支付和语言问题,更重要的是如何在不同国家和地区构建真实、稳定的网络访问...
住宅 IP 与数据中心 IP 有何不同?一文读懂代理 IP 的选择逻辑
在代理 IP 的实际应用中,住宅 IP 与数据中心 IP 是最常被提及的两种类型。二者虽然都能作为网络访问的出口地址,但...